Also be aware that screen recording video from a paid streaming service may violate the terms of service for that service provider. It may also be illegal in your country. Download and install Mozilla Firefox. Most video streaming services like Netflix and Hulu have copyright protection in their videos.

When you try to screen capture videos from these services, you will see a black screen when viewing the recorded video. Open the installer file in your web browser or Downloads folder.
